Join us in exploring the untold stories of remarkable African American figures who broke barriers and paved the way for others in our online course, "Hidden Figures: Black Trailblazers in American History." This course delves into the lives and contributions of inventors, educators, lawyers, and more, highlighting the often-overlooked achievements in traditional education systems. Through engaging video content and insightful discussions, participants will deepen their understanding of black history, enhance their appreciation for diversity, and acquire knowledge that fosters inclusion and equity in today's society. Expect to be inspired by the resilience and ingenuity of these trailblazers as we uncover the rich tapestry of contributions that shaped American history.
